  • The food quality of lupin seed, i.e. soaking, cooking, sprout growing and mold growing for fermentation, was investigated by using the seed of Lupinus angustifolius harvested in Western Australia. A method to produce lupin seed protein concentrate (LPC) was developed, and the wage of LPC in Korean food system was investigated. The water soaking rate of lupin seed was faster than that of soybean, but the cooking rate of lupin seed was much slower compared to soybean. The thermal softening time, $D_{100}$, was 345 min for lupin seed and 84 min for soybean. A two-phase solvent extraction system consisting of haxane-alcohol-water could effectively remove the residual bitter taste, lipid and yellow pigments of lupin seed flour, and the resulting LPC contained over 50% protein and had bland flavor and milky white color. Treatment of LPC with carbohydrate decomposing enzymes resulted in a product of more soluble and higher concentration of protein. Methods to produce lupin seed vegetable milk and lactic beverages from LPC products were discussed.

  • The changes of resistant starch (RS) contents of cooked rice with soybean and coconut oils under different storage conditions were investigated and RS contents were compared between the rice and cooker types. The japonica (Hopyeong) and the indica (Thailand) type rice were cooked (washed rice: water = 100: 130) using an electric cooker and a saucepan. The coconut oil and soybean oil (3%, based on rice, w/w) were added into cooking water before heating. The RS contents of freeze-dried cooked rice powders (newly-cooked rice, stored for 12 h in the refrigerator, microwave heating after storage for 12 h in the refrigerator) were measured by the AOAC method. The RS contents of cooked rice using a saucepan were higher than those using an electric cooker. The indica type cooked rice had a higher RS content than the japonica type cooked rice, regardless of storage conditions. However, addition of oil before cooking rice resulted in increased RS content on storage in the refrigerator. The highest RS content of the cooked indica type rice with soybean oil ($5.89{\pm}0.22%$) that was stored for 12 h in the refrigerator was analyzed. The results suggested that the cooked rice formed retrograded (RS3) and amylose-lipid complex (RS5) type RS; furthermore, the RS content is affected by storage conditions, rice, cooker and oil types.

  • This study examined the ingredients and cooking methods of side dishes in "Chosunmusangsinsikyorijebub" during the year of 1924, approximately. In the recipe for Tang (Guk), there was much use of various parts of beef, fish, shellfish, vegetables, and mushrooms, and soybean paste, hot pepper paste, and soy sauce were used as seasonings. For Chootang and Byulchootang, cinnamon powder was added at the end of cooking. In foods such as Tang (Guk), Gigimi, Chigye, Chim, and steamed dishes, which were made of beef, pork, chicken, various fish, Chinese cabbage, and over ripened cucumbers, and thickened by adding buckwheat powder or wheat powder, the taste of the food was changed by controlling the gravy content. In the recipe for Gorim-Cho, ingredients such as beef, pork, chicken, and various fish were used, which were cooked in boiling water and soy sauce. Boiling or steaming were employed as the cooking methods for Baeksuk, where beef rib Baeksuk was seasoned with salt and fermented shrimp and then boiled. For porgy and herring Baeksuk, the internal organs of the fish were first removed, and then they were steamed with pine needles. Hoei incorporated the flesh of various meats, various beef organs, pork skin, and fish as ingredients, and different dipping sauces and pine nut powder were also used.

  • The sensory evaluation by Preference test revealed that the best Kongjook was obtained when the soymilk was prepared with eight-times of water to the volume of soybean. Based on the results, the ratios of soybean: rice: water (v/v/v) having 2:1:16($G_1$), 3:2:24($G_2$), 3:2:30($G_3$),and 4:3:32($G_4$), were chosen. The soaked rice was cooked with soymilk, Kongjook prepared from $G_2$ and $G_4$, showed the highes preference in eating quality and flavor, but the former had better quality in consistency and color, indicating that Kongjook from $G_2$ was the most preferable. The cooking time of soybean prior to the preparation of soymilk also showed that Kongjook prepared from $G_2$ had better preference than other samples regardless of the cooking times of soybean. The spreadability of Kongjook from $G_2$ determined with a line-chart method was 5.85.

  • The effect of soybean flour (0, 5, 10, and 15%) on the quality characteristics (moisture, color, water absorption, solid content, texture properties, and sensory properties) of Topokkidduk stored for two days was studied. The moisture content of Topokkidduk increased with increasing soybean flour concentration at all the storage times. The moisture contents of SF15 (soybean flour 15%) on storage days 0, 1, and 2 were 46.30, 46.30, and 45.00%, respectively. SF15 had the highest moisture content among all the samples. The color of Topokkidduk (L value) decreased whereas its a and b values significantly increased with increased soybean flour concentration (p<0.05). The cooking properties (e.g., water absorption and solid content) resulted from the opposite conditions. Thus, the water absorption decreased and the solid content increased with increasing soybean flour concentration. The texture analyzer revealed that the hardness, chewiness, and cohesiveness of Topokkidduk decreased and that its adhesiveness increased with soybean flour addition, but there were no significant differences in these according to the soybean powder concentration. The taste, flavor, color, hardness, springiness, and overall acceptability values of Topokkidduk containing SF5 (soybean flour 5%) after two storage days, obtained through a sensory test, were highest among all the samples. These results suggest that soybean flour may be utilized as a functional and valuable ingredient in Topokkidduk.

  • Soaking of soybeans and the subsequent effect on cooking kinetics were investigated by the means of puncture test and shear press with Instron universal testing machine. Soaked soybeans were water cooked at temperatures of $90{\sim}135^{\circ}C$ adjusted with oil bath. Instron puncture force of 0.15kg and shear force of 1.2kg/g-soybean were appeared as the eating soft texture by sensory evaluation. Softening activation energies of yellow soybeans for puncture and shear force were 14,540cal/g-mole and 21,374cal/g-mole. z-values were calculated as $42.1^{\circ}C$ and $37.4^{\circ}C$, respectively.

  • Objective: Frankfurters are emulsion-type sausages that are widely consumed worldwide. However, some concerns regarding negative health effects have been raised because of the high fat content and the type of fat. This study aimed to evaluate the effects of duck fat and κ-carrageenan as replacements for beef fat and pork backfat in frankfurters. Methods: The different formulations for the frankfurters were as follows: 20% beef fat (BF), 20% pork backfat (PBF), 20% duck fat (DF), 20% soybean oil (SO), 20% duck fat/1% κ-carrageenan (DFC), and 20% soybean oil/1% κ-carrageenan (SOC). Physicochemical (fatty acid profile, color, rheological properties, cooking loss, water holding capacity, emulsion stability, and texture profile analysis), oxidative stability and sensory properties of frankfurters were evaluated. Results: Duck fat and κ-carrageenan improved rheological properties of meat batter, and physicochemical properties (emulsion stability, cooking loss, and hardness) of frankfurters. Moreover, duck fat added-frankfurters (DF and DFC) had higher oxidative stability than that of soybean-added frankfurters (SO and SOC) during refrigerated storage for 28 days. In sensory evaluation, flavor, texture, and overall acceptability of DFC were acceptable to untrained panelists. Conclusion: Our data suggest that duck fat and κ-carrageenan can replace beef fat and pork backfat in frankfurters. Duck fat and κ-carrageenan contributed to improve the physicochemical properties and oxidative stability while maintaining sensory properties. Therefore, the use of duck fat and κ-carrageenan may be a suitable alternative for replacing beef fat or pork backfat in frankfurters.

  • Preferences of 814 elderly living in Incheon for dishes, food materials and cooking methods were investigated. The survey was conducted from Dec. 2000 to Jan. 2001 by questionnaires. Subjects preferred cooked rice with beans, kalkooksoo(hot noodle), gomtang(soup with beef), bibimbap(rice with assorted mixture) to other staple dishes. However, preference for hashed rice or curried rice was very low. More than 50% of the subjects liked soybean paste soup and stew, and the ratio of elderly who liked Chinese cabbage kimchi was 68.7%. There was no significant difference in preference for pan-fried foods according to food materials in them. Subjects liked injolmi(waxy rice cake), shikhye(fermented rice drink) and coffee the most. Most subjects preferred plant foods like vegetables, legumes and seaweeds to animal foods. Preference of elderly for milk and yoghurt was reatively high; however, that for ham, butter and cheese was low. Elderly in Incheon liked roasted beef, beef soup and roasted pork the most. Chicken was preferred when it was boiled in water with garlic, ginseng, and so on. Cooked and seasoned vegetables (Namul) were the most preferred type by elderly. Preferences for dishes and food materials were more affected by living places of the subjects than by sex, and the reverse was true in preference for cooking method of food materials.

  • Seed characteristics such as seed size, seed shape and cotyledon color are important in relation to processing and cooking of soybean. Seed shape, water absorption rate, and alkali digestibility were evaluated for 28 local black soybean collections. Water uptake rate was low in small seed size at low temperature(5, 2$0^{\circ}C$). However, higher water absorption rate was observed at high temperature(40, 6$0^{\circ}C$) regardless of seed size. When seeds soaked up water, it reached to water absorption equilibrium after 10 hrs below 2$0^{\circ}C$, within 10 hrs at 4$0^{\circ}C$, and around 4 hrs at 6$0^{\circ}C$, respectively. Significant positive correlations were observed between 100 seed weight and length, width and thickness of seed, respectively. Alkali digestibility value(ADV) was higher in large seed group than in small seed group. Among seed characteristics, significant positive correlation was shown between ADV and 100 seed weight, length, width, thickness and hilum length of seed, respectively. Soybean seed with green cotyledon showed higher ADV than that with yellow cotyledon.
